news in briefinternational student association (ISA)The International Student Association is a new committee which aims to increase engagement, participation and representation of non-UK students within the Students’ Union. As with the PGA, its role will be to pass resolutions on issues directly affecting international students at Warwick, and bring these to both Student Council and All Student Meetings. Look out for more information about our first meeting of the year coming soon, in which we’ll electing councillors to represent you for the year!
The Postgraduate Association is our one-stop shop for all things related to postgrad representation here at the SU. The committee is made up of the Postgraduate Officer, the 4 elected Faculty Representatives, and a PGR rep and Social Secretary who will be elected at the first meeting. Our regular meetings will be open to all postgraduate students, and we want as many of you to come along as possible. We will be discussing both academic and non-academic issues, and hopefully bringing policy along to All Student Meetings so that we can enact change and make a real difference to the lives of postgrad students.

Week 3 will see the Students’ Union awash in a tide of orange publicity and the return of a certain cheeky-looking hamster as we urge you to cast your vote in the 2012 Autumn Elections. So, what’s it all about?
Your elected representatives can make a big difference. Do you want to risk the development of your student experience to just anyone? The best way to help enact the change that you want to see is by electing the best people to represent your views.
Following on from last year’s Democracy Review, we are currently electing Postgraduate Faculty Representatives to join the Postgrad Association, together with Student Council Councillors from all year groups. The election of Undergraduate Faculty Representatives occurs during the Officer Elections in Term 2.Student Council meets five times a year and acts as the overseer of policy implementation here at the SU, making sure that things get done by your elected Officer Team. They also update policies due for renewal, as well as proposing policy at All Student Meetings. If you have an interest in what your Union does and how we go about putting this into action, it’s really important that you have your say!

for those of you who missed it last year, The Exchange is a Bar FTSE game that turns the Copper Rooms bar into a stock exchange for the evening!We will “float” products on the “market”, which will be displayed on screens around the venue. Drinks prices will rise and fall through the night depending on demand, just like on the real stock exchange - so, if eveyone is buying Carlsberg, grolsch will drop in price... so people start buying grolsch and the price goes back up and Carlsberg falls!
